A Bottle of Rain is that kind of love story involving a mute clown, a blind gypsy fortune-teller, FBI agents, an award-winning poet told to teach fiction, and now the last Kickapoo Indian girl born in Champaign County has, along with her pacemaker, returned to  the Land of Lincoln in search of her parents.  She finds Emily and Jacob instead.  Emily is a telephone operator who has dropped out of college for a horrible reason and is plotting to kill Ronald Reagan, and Jacob is a sad luck divorced college student who mourns the lost time with his daughter each and every day.  All in the year of our Lord, 1986.  Along the way you’ll get a brief history of computers, a not so brief history of the Kickapoo Indian Tribe (told in a somewhat unorthodox manner), a revisionist view of Abraham Lincoln,  and plenty of the most essential elements of a good love story (sex and laughter).
